Perennial Landscaping in Ventura County, CA
Perennial landscaping services focus on the design, installation, and maintenance of long-lasting plantings that provide year-round beauty and structure to residential properties. These services typically include selecting suitable perennial flowers, shrubs, and ground covers, as well as planting, pruning, and caring for them to ensure healthy growth over multiple seasons. Homeowners often request perennial landscaping to create colorful borders, low-maintenance gardens, or natural-looking landscapes that enhance curb appeal and provide ongoing enjoyment without frequent replanting.
Before requesting perennial landscaping, property owners should consider factors such as local climate conditions, soil quality, and the specific sunlight and water needs of desired plants. It’s also helpful to have an understanding of the existing landscape layout and any preferred styles or themes. Clarifying goals for the landscape, whether for aesthetic appeal, privacy, or habitat creation, can assist in selecting the most suitable plant varieties and design approaches for a sustainable, attractive outdoor space.
